Barbecue Grills 8. … WebJan 31, 2024 · The top three causes of fires in homes are cooking, heating equipment, and electrical malfunction (FEMA). It can take just 30 seconds for a small flame to turn into a major blaze (Department of Homeland Security). An average of 358,500 homes experience a structural fire each year (NFPA). More than 3,000 Americans die in fires each year (FEMA).
WebHome fires caused by cooking peaked at Thanksgiving and Christmas. In 2024, fire departments responded to an average of 470 home cooking fires per day. WebMar 26, 2016 · Aim at the base of the fire — not the flames. Never use water to put out grease fires! Water repels grease and can spread the fire by splattering the grease. … church wide work day clip artWebAug 26, 2024 · Cleaning the toaster vents and other surfaces with residue can prevent fires.
